Google seems to be testing the rollout of top stories within the AI Overview section of the Google Search results. This was something Google pre-announced last month and it now seems to be rolling out to some searchers.

Lily Ray first spotted this and posted about it on X and I was able to replicate it in one of my browser sessions – not all:

Google Ai Overview Carousel Stories

The screenshot on the right shows a Top Stories carousel with content from The New York Times, Yahoo and others. I didn’t see the preferred sources, but I assume they can show up if there is content that matches your query to your preferred sources.

Google wrote in May, “for some searches when you have a question about a developing topic, you’ll start seeing a prominent carousel, which will also highlight your Preferred Sources. This will help make timely articles more visible on a wider range of queries.”

This UI change can be a big improvement and send nice traffic to publishers.
